Helena Tynell

Helena Tynell (1935–2021) was a Finnish glass artist known for her distinctive designs and contributions to the Finnish glass industry. She was born in Finland and is best remembered for her work in glass-blowing, designing glass pieces that combined functionality with artistic expression. Tynell's work often showcased the natural beauty of Finland's landscapes, and she was skilled in using various glass-making techniques, including glassblowing, casting, and pressing.
